Which equation is a decomposition reaction?a. Li2CO3 ---> Li2O + CO2

b. Zn + HCl ---> ZnCl2 + H2

c. Na2O + CO2 ---> Na2CO3

d. C6H12O6 + O2 ---> CO2 + H2O


please help asap

Answers

Answer : (a) Li_2CO_3\rightarrow Li_2O+CO_2 is a decomposition reaction.

Explanation :

(a)Li_2CO_3\rightarrow Li_2O+CO_2 is a decomposition reaction.

  • Decomposition reaction : It is a type of chemical reaction in which a single compound decomposes into two or more compounds.

(b)Zn+2HCl\rightarrow ZnCl_2+H_2 is a displacement reaction.

  • Displacement reaction : It is a type of reaction in which a most reactive element displaces the least reactive element in a compound.

(c)Na_2O+CO_2\rightarrow Na_2CO_3 is a combination reaction.

  • Combination reaction : It is a type of reaction where two or more compounds combine to form a single compound.

(d)C_6H_(12)O_6+6O_2\rightarrow 6CO_2+6H_2O is a combustion reaction.

  • Combustion reaction : It is a type of reaction where a hydrocarbon react with the oxygen to produced carbon dioxide and water.

Therefore, option (a) is a decomposition reaction.

A certain reaction has an activation energy of 66.41 kJ/mol. At what Kelvin temperature will the reaction proceed 3.00 times faster than it did at 293 K?

Answers

Answer : The temperature will be, 392.462 K

Explanation :

According to the Arrhenius equation,

K=A* e^{(-Ea)/(RT)}

or,

\log ((K_2)/(K_1))=(Ea)/(2.303* R)[(1)/(T_1)-(1)/(T_2)]

where,

K_1 = rate constant at T_1  = K_1

K_2 = rate constant at T_2 = 3K_1

Ea = activation energy for the reaction = 66.41 kJ/mole = 66410 J/mole

R = gas constant = 8.314 J/mole.K

T_1 = initial temperature = 293 K

T_2 = final temperature = ?

Now put all the given values in this formula, we get:

\log ((3K_1)/(K_1))=(66410J/mole)/(2.303* 8.314J/mole.K)[(1)/(293K)-(1)/(T_2)]

T_2=392.462K

Therefore, the temperature will be, 392.462 K

You have a stock bottle of HCl (aq) which is 12.1M, You need 400 mL of 0.10M HCl. How much of the acid and how much water will you need?

Answers

Mols of acid needed: 0.4 liters x 0.10 mol/liter = 0.04 mol

Volumen of acid in the bottle than contaiins 0.04 mol of acid: V = #moles/M = 0.04 mol/12.1 mol/liter = 0.003306 liters = 3.306 ml

Then you need 3.3 ml of acid from the bottle and 396.7 ml of pure water to get 400 ml of acid 0,1 M

Given the equation representing a system at equilibrium:N2(g) + 3H2(g)<==>2NH3(g) + energyWhich changes occur when the temperature of this system is decreased?
(1) The concentration of H2(g) increases and the concentration of N2(g) increases.
(2) The concentration of H2(g) decreases and the concentration of N2(g) increases.
(3) The concentration of H2(g) decreases and the concentration of NH3(g) decreases.
(4) The concentration of H2(g) decreases and the concentration of NH3(g) increases.

Answers

When the temperature is decreased, the concentration of H2(g) decreases and the concentration of NH3(g) increases.

What is equilibrium?

The term equilibrium refers to the point when the rate of forward reaction is equal to the rate of reverse reaction. In that case, the reaction has attained a dynamic equilibrium.

Now, when the temperature is decreased, the concentration of H2(g) decreases and the concentration of NH3(g) increases.
